What was the capital city of Japan during the Middle Ages?

Respuesta :

jincejoby832
jincejoby832 jincejoby832
  • 06-10-2021

Answer:

From 794 through 1868, the Emperor lived in Heian-kyō, modern-day Kyoto. After 1868, the seat of the Government of Japan and the location of the Emperor's home was moved to Edo, which it renamed Tokyo.
